I downloaded the insimenator, put it in my lot through buy mode (electronics section).

There are many parts to the insimenator, I mean that there are many items associated to it, they look like sims items from the base game, but have different functions, they are marked as CC though.  Everything associated with the insimenator should be in the electronics section.

The plumbob is what lets you change the sims motives.  It looks like the green thing above your sims head, but it can be interacted with.  You put that on your lot and whenever you feel overwhelmed, just click on that -- and there should be a option that lets you put everyone's motives at 100%.
